MVNO Subscribers to Hit 438 Million Globally by 2030

The number of mobile subscribers using Mobile Virtual Network Operators (MVNOs) will increase from 333 million globally in 2026 to 438 million in 2030. Key to this substantial growth of over 100 million subscribers will be MVNO in a Box platforms, which are enabling a surge in enterprises launching mobile connectivity services.
